Single cell dynamic phenotyping.
Scientific reports - 6 Oct 2016
Patsch Katherin, Chiu Chi-Li, Engeln Mark, Agus David B, Mallick Parag, Mumenthaler Shannon M, Ruderman Daniel
Abstract excerpt
Live cell imaging has improved our ability to measure phenotypic heterogeneity. However, bottlenecks in imaging and image processing often make it difficult to differentiate interesting biological behavior from technical artifact. Thus there is a need for new methods that improve data quality without sacrificing throughput. Here we present a 3-step workflow to improve dynamic phenotype measurements of...
